Fabrication of Freeform Optics

Freeform surfaces on optical components have become an important design tool for optical designers. Non-rotationally symmetric optical surfaces have made solving complex optical problems easier. The manufacturing and testing of these surfaces has been the technical hurdle in freeform optic’s wide-spread use. Manufacturing and measurement of freeform optics

Freeform optics is the next-generation of modern optics, bringing advantages of excellent optical performance and system integration. It finds wide applications in various fields, such as new energy, illumination, aerospace and biomedical engineering.
